Web Applications / Website Design and Development Instructor

MINIMUM QUALIFICATIONS: Applicant must have a Master’s degree in Computer Science or a related field or a Master’s degree with a minimum of 18 semester hours in Computer Science from a regionally accredited college or university. Proficiency in web design and development software and technologies required. Applicant must display ability to work with PHP, and must display excellent written and verbal communication skills.

PREFERRED QUALIFICATIONS: In addition to the minimum qualifications previous post-secondary teaching experience is preferred.

RESPONSIBILITIES: This individual will be responsible for teaching day or evening lecture and laboratory classes in web design and web application and have an ability to convey technical concepts effectively to different constituencies at a level appropriate to the audience, and an understanding of the mission of technical education.  Under general supervision, prepares lesson plans for classroom and laboratory instruction; develops program curriculum, syllabi, goals, and objectives; evaluates students’ progress in attaining goals and objectives; prepares and maintains all required documentation and administrative reports; attends various professional development training; assists with recruitment, retention, and job placement efforts. The position may require committee and project assignments. Other duties as assigned.

SALARY/BENEFITS:  This is a part-time position with no insurance benefits; salary is commensurate with education and work experience.
